About
Platform offering infrastructure and applications powering next-gen on-chain games. It utilizes blockchain technology to provide on-chain games powered entirely by smart contracts, enabling players to draft rules and interact with other players in the game. The company was founded in 2021 and headquartered in San Francisco, United States. It has raised $8.7M in series a funding, with backing from Bain Capital Crypto, SevenX Ventures, OKX, TCG, and others. The company operates in the Gaming - PC & Console Gaming, Gaming - Gaming Tech space. Its offerings span Gaming Tech - Development - Game Engines - NFTs.
